Abstract :
Custom Power is a concept based on the application of power electronic controllers in distribution systems to supply reliable power. Digital simulation can be a very effective way to evaluate the performance of techniques aimed at mitigating the effects of power quality disturbances. Electromagnetic transients programs (EMTPs) are circuit-oriented tools based on a time-domain solution method that are becoming very popular in modeling and simulation of custom power equipment. In this paper EMTP solution methods and capabilities are reviewed, as well as their application to modeling and simulation of Custom Power solutions
